W tym poradniku omówimy kluczową różnicę pomiędzy SQL i MySQL. Przed omówieniem różnic między SQL i MYSQL, najpierw przyjrzyjmy się im indywidualnie, czym jest SQL i czym jest MySQL, aby lepiej je zrozumieć.
Co to jest SQL?
SQL jest językiem, który jest używany do obsługi bazy danych. SQL jest podstawowym językiem używanym we wszystkich bazach danych. Istnieją drobne zmiany w składni pomiędzy różnymi bazami danych, ale podstawowa składnia SQL pozostaje w dużej mierze taka sama. SQL jest skrótem od Structured Query Language. Według ANSI (American National Standards Institute), SQL jest standardowym językiem do obsługi systemu zarządzania relacyjną bazą danych.
Język SQL jest używany w dostępie, aktualizacji i manipulacji danymi w bazie danych. Jego konstrukcja pozwala na zarządzanie danymi w systemie RDBMS, takim jak MYSQL. Język SQL służy również do kontroli dostępu do danych oraz do tworzenia i modyfikacji schematów baz danych.
Czym jest MYSQL?
Opracowany w połowie lat 90-tych, MySQL był jedną z pierwszych baz danych typu open-source dostępnych na rynku. Obecnie istnieje wiele alternatywnych wariantów MySQL. Różnice między nimi nie są jednak znaczące, ponieważ korzystają z tej samej składni, a podstawowa funkcjonalność również pozostaje taka sama.
MySQL jest systemem RDBMS, który pozwala na utrzymanie porządku w danych znajdujących się w bazie danych. MySQL jest wymawiany jako „My S-Q-L”, ale jest również nazywany „My Sequel”. Jego nazwa pochodzi od imienia córki współzałożyciela Michaela Wideniusa. MySQL zapewnia dostęp do baz danych dla wielu użytkowników. Ten system RDBMS jest używany w połączeniu z PHP i Apache Web Server, na szczycie dystrybucji Linux. MySQL wykorzystuje język SQL do zadawania zapytań do bazy danych.
KEY DIFFERENCE:
- SQL jest językiem, który jest używany do obsługi bazy danych, podczas gdy MySQL był jedną z pierwszych baz danych typu open-source dostępnych na rynku
- SQL jest używany w dostępie, aktualizacji i manipulacji danych w bazie danych, podczas gdy MySQL jest RDBMS, który pozwala na utrzymanie danych istniejących w bazie danych w porządku
- SQL jest Strukturalnym Językiem Zapytań, a MySQL jest RDBMS do przechowywania, wyszukiwania, modyfikowania i administrowania bazą danych.
- SQL jest językiem zapytań, podczas gdy MYSQL jest oprogramowaniem bazodanowym
Teraz zobaczmy różnicę między SQL a MySQL
Różnice pomiędzy SQL a MySQL
Poniżej przedstawiono kilka kluczowych różnic pomiędzy SQL Vs MySQL
Parametr | SQL | MYSQL |
---|---|---|
Definicja | SQL to strukturalny język zapytań (Structured Query Language). Jest on przydatny do zarządzania relacyjnymi bazami danych. | MySQL to system RDBMS do przechowywania, pobierania, modyfikowania i administrowania bazami danych przy użyciu językaSQL. |
Złożoność | Trzeba się nauczyć języka SQL, aby móc go efektywnie używać. | Jest on łatwo dostępny poprzez pobranie i instalację. |
Typ | SQL jest językiem zapytań. | MySQL jest oprogramowaniem bazodanowym. Używa języka „SQL” do odpytywania bazy danych. |
Wsparcie dla konektorów | SQL nie dostarcza konektorów. | MySQL oferuje zintegrowane narzędzie o nazwie „MySQL workbench” do projektowania i tworzenia baz danych. |
Zastosowanie | Do tworzenia zapytań i obsługi systemu baz danych. | Pozwala na obsługę danych, przechowywanie, modyfikowanie, usuwanie w formacie tabelarycznym. |
Usage | Kod i polecenia MySQL są używane w różnych systemach DBMS i RDMS, w tym MYSQL. | MYSQL jest używany jako baza danych RDBMS. |
Updates | Język jest stały, a polecenia pozostają takie same. | Uzyskaj częste aktualizacje |